Thursday was an amazing day, capping off a three-day storm cycle that brought 32-35 inches of snow. I hope you were able to enjoy at least one of these days!

The weather on Friday and Saturday should be dry, but keep your powder legs strong as snow will return with a few inches on Sunday, followed by light snow on Monday then potentially heavy snow on Tuesday and/or Wednesday!
